December 9, 2023 - Dried strawberries and cedar on the nose. Smooth and resolved tannins lead to a punch in the throat of acidity and lingering notes of blood orange and chinotto. I mean that in a good way. Oddly moreish for such a big wine, though the bigness is really only felt in a touch of lingering heat on swallowing. Was worried as the cork crumbled on opening but it’s totally fine and in a nice place, I would guess unlikely to improve further.

December 18, 2022 - Purchased a couple of bottles of this a few years ago as MJ are one of my favourite Brunello producers. 2009 not billed as a great vintage and hence the suggested drinking window is a little shorter than normal for this wine. Opened and decanted for a couple of hours. Heady full and rich aroma with a little hint of age but it was on the palate that the wine truly delivered. Earthy and quite rich, tannins perfectly resolved, a little leather and aromatic black cherry fruit. Almost Barolo like in character. Drunk over three hours and the last glass was singing. Delicious wine, great value when purchased young and buried for a few years. I don't see any further development for this wine - perfect for drinking now and over the next year or two max.
